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65750820 37 91391498 913450
62 16 086522
62 16 086522
73548422 22539808 82679
All about undefined
Interested in learning more?
62 16 086522
73548422 22539808 82679
See more
00 7377212853
62219749012 428 85486 8980041001
See more
50668 69 11658
5746958 29290930143 989
See more